              <text>Keris lurus sebagai lambang keteguhan hati dan kekuatan iman. Bentuk keris tersebut juga melambangkan kepercayaan dan kekuasaan Tuhan Yang Maha Esa. Keris luk tiga sebagai lambang permohonan kepada Tuhan supaya cita-cita (duniawi dan rohani) dapat tercapai dan semua rintangan teratasi. &#13;

                <text>Keris telah terdapat di Sumenep sejak abad ke-13 atau pada masa Pangeran Adipoday, Raja Sumenep. Ada Desa Wisata Keris Keberadaan keris kemudian dilanjutkan oleh putranya yang bernama Pangeran Joko Tole. Joko Tole juga merupakan anak angkat dari Empu Kelleng, seorang ahli besi. Dimana pada masa dahulu, keris adalah senjata perang. &#13;
&#13;
Hingga saat ini, tradisi membuat keris terus berlanjut dan menjadikan Sumenep dijuluki sebagai Kota Keris. Sumenep memiliki ratusan empu pembuat keris yang dapat membuat keris sesuai keinginan pemesan, seperti ada keris gaya Majapahit, model Mataram, maupun model Madura. Jumlah pengrajin keris tersebar di sejumlah wilayah di Sumenep, seperti Kecamatan Saronggi, Kecamatan Lenteng, dan Kecamatan Bluto.&#13;

                <text> Hidden in an old fashion shophouse in Permas, Kukup here, is a man who has been keeping the Malay art of keris-making alive for decades. What makes it even more special is that he is a Malaysian of Chinese descent.&#13;
&#13;
Lai Kah Foh, 71, said that his interest in forging the traditional Malay dagger started when he was 13-years old while he was helping his blacksmith father.</text>

              <text>Asal usul keris belum jelas.  Karena, tidak ada sumber diskriptif tentang keris sebelum abad ke 15. Walaupun, penyebutan keris telah tercantum dalam prasasti ke 9 M.  Kajian ilmiah tentang perkembangan keris diperoleh melalui analisis relief candi atau patung.. Termasuk dengan fungsi keris yang dapat dilacak melalui prasasti dan laporan-laporan penjelajah asing ke Nusantara.  &#13;

                <text>Keris merupakan senjata tikam dalam kelompok belati yang dikenal di kawasan Nusantara. Keris memiliki susunan yang mudah dibedakan dengan senjata tajam lainnya. Keris memiliki bentuk asimeteris dan di bagian pangkalnya melebar. Bilahnya sering terlihat berkelok-kelok. Pada masa lalu, keris digunakan sebagai senjata tajam dalam peperangan sekaligus sebagai benda sesaji. &#13;
&#13;
Seperti pada masa kerajaan Majapahit, keris merupakan senjata umum yang digunakan masyarakat diberbagai kalangan sosial.&#13;

              <text>The Keris is a complex piece of art, with each detail having significant meanings and serving specific magical and spiritual purposes.&#13;
&#13;
The blade of the keris, the hilt and also the scabbard all present their own iconography. However, these last two elements are seen as subject to changes. Only the blade remains a constant, and only the blade is regarded as having a spiritual element.&#13;
&#13;
Keris blades have two kinds of shape: straight and meandering. There are approximately 200 kinds of straight keris and 250 kinds of meandering keris.&#13;

                <text>A keris is a double-edged asymmetrical dagger originating in Java. It is both a weapon and a ritual object loaded with spiritual significance. Keris are also indigenous to Malaysia, Thailand, Brunei, Singapore and the Philippines where it is known as kalis, with sword variants.&#13;
&#13;
The keris is widely distributed throughout the areas of influence of the Majapahit Empire, and in the Cham areas of Cambodia, who are heirs to the ancient Shiva-Buddha religion that once spanned all of Southeast Asia. It also appeared in the Dong-Son culture of Vietnam as early as 300 B.C.&#13;

              <text>Menghasilkan sebilah keris merupakan perkara yang tidak mudah. Kadang-kala, sebanyak 17 logam yang berbeza digunakan dalam pembuatan keris, dan setiap logam ini mempunyai ciri-ciri khas.  Antara logam yang digunakan ialah ‘Pulasani’ dan ‘Pamor’.&#13;
&#13;
Penghasilan sebuah keris pula mengambil masa paling kurang dua minggu, tetapi mampu juga berlanjutan hingga sebulan bergantung kepada kualiti dan keunikan keris tersebut. Sebelum memulakan proses pembuatan pula, ayat suci Al-Quran harus dibacakan supaya pembuatan berjalan dengan lancar. Sesetengah orang pula membaca doa-doa tertentu supaya keris tersebut ‘bersemangat’.&#13;

                <text>Keris merupakan satu senjata dan alat mempertahankan diri yang sangat unik di kalangan masyarakat Melayu pada zaman dahulu. Pahlawan dan pembesar tanah air mempunyai talian yang erat dengan keris kerana gandingan ini telah berjaya menentang anasir luar.&#13;
&#13;
Dengan reka bentuknya yang lain daripada yang lain, sebilah keris digunakan sebagai senjata terakhir di medan peperangan. Walaupun pendek, ia sangat berbahaya dan sesiapa yang ditikam dengan keris pasti akan merana dan kecederaannya boleh membawa maut.&#13;
&#13;
Keris ini dapat menunjukkan betapa hebatnya pemikiran orang Melayu pada zaman dulu, kerana setiap bahan, kaedah pembuatan, dan cara penggunaannya sangat terperinci dan bersebab. Dengan kata lainnya, sebilah keris bukan sesuatu senjata yang boleh dipandang remeh.</text>

              <text>In 2018, the Yayasan Raja Muda Selangor (YRMS) found that there were fewer than 10 keris-makers alive today in Malaysia.&#13;
&#13;
Realising the need to preserve the art and skill, YRMS started training three young men under its “Talent for The World” training series.&#13;
&#13;
“With the three new young keris-makers, the YRMS has initiated the sustainability of the art of keris-making,’’ said board of trustees chairman Raja Tan Sri Arshad Raja Tun Uda.</text>

                <text>Keris-making is an ancient art, going back to the ninth century and it remains a very important component of Malay history, tradition and culture.&#13;
&#13;
Sadly, the art form as well as the keris-making trade is slowly disappearing as most of the masters in the field are no more or are ageing.</text>

              <text>Sheikh Abdul Sani berkata masyarakat hari ini memandang mudah dalam melakukan acara mandikan keris dengan mengunakan bahan asas dan kadang-kala tidak bersesuaian dengan keris tertentu.&#13;
&#13;
Beliau yang juga pengumpul senjata tradisional Melayu berkata bahan yang digunakan untuk mandikan keris berbeza mengikut campuran besi yang diguna untuk membuat keris tersebut, adat mandikan keris yang dibuat daripada lebih tujuh jenis besi adalah lebih rumit berbanding dengan keris biasa.&#13;
&#13;
Katanya terdapat empat peringkat mandikan keris iaitu peringkat pertama adalah acara mandikan bagi membuang kotoran, karat dan bisa dengan merendam keris tersebut dalam tempoh tertentu dalam bekas berisi samada air kelapa, air nenas, asam jawa, air kapur dan sebangainya.</text>

                <text>Pada zaman dahulu fungsi keris bukan hanya sebagai senjata tetapi ianya dijadikan sebagai simbol utusan kerajaan, lambang darjat, pangkat kepada pemiliknya sehingga ada upacara khas untuk memandikan keris yang dilakukan orang tertentu yang digelar “Empu keris”. &#13;
&#13;
Empu keris (Tukang mandikan keris), Sheikh Abdul Sani Sheikh Hashim, 55 berkata masyarakat dahulu lebih menghargai keris sehingga ianya dianggap sebagai khazanah berharga, ianya dijaga dengan baik dan dimandikan mengikut adat serta pantang larangnya, namum hari ini orang ramai tidak lagi menjaga keris dan hanya membiarkanya tergantung di dinding rumah.</text>

              <text>The shape of the Keris is quite unique and not found in any other weapon or dagger in the world. It has curves or waves that give the Keris its unique identity. The Keris is also a revered object and is part of the royal regalia.&#13;
&#13;
The Keris’ beauty is made complete by the intricately carved wooden handle or hilt that sometimes depicts the shape of a kingfisher or other objects inspired by nature.&#13;
&#13;
The best Keris makers are found in Kampung Pasir Panjang and Kampung Ladang Titian in Kuala Terengganu.</text>

                <text>The Keris is a traditional Malay dagger and is regarded as a cultural symbol of the Malays. The Keris is meant to not only physically protect the wearer and owner but is believed to hold mystical powers that further shields its owner from further harm. Legend has it that the owner would know danger lurking if the Keris starts to rattle in its sheath.</text>
